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Black-fronted Duiker | Zorro Volador de Cabeza Gris |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(cordados) | Chordata (cordados) |
| Class same | Mammalia (mamíferos) | Mammalia (mamíferos) |
| Order | Artiodactyla (artiodáctilos) | Chiroptera (Bats) |
| Family | Bovidae (Bovids) | Pteropodidae (Fruit Bats) |
| Genus | Cephalophus | Pteropus (Flying Foxes) |
| Species | Cephalophus nigrifrons | Pteropus poliocephalus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Black-fronted Duiker and Zorro Volador de Cabeza Gris share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(mamíferos)
